USING THE UNIT SAFELY
Turn o the unit if an abnormality or 
malfunction occurs
Immediately turn the unit o, 
remove the power cord from the 
outlet, and request servicing by 
your retailer, the nearest Roland 
Service Center, or an authorized Roland 
distributor, as listed on the “Information” 
when:
•  The power cord has been damaged; or
•  If smoke or unusual odor occurs; or
•  Objects have fallen into, or liquid has been 
spilled onto the unit; or
•  The unit has been exposed to rain (or 
otherwise has become wet); or
•  The unit does not appear to operate 
normally or exhibits a marked change in 
performance.
 
Be cautious to protect children from injury
Always make sure that an adult is 
on hand to provide supervision and 
guidance when using the unit in 
places where children are present, 
or when a child will be using the unit.
Do not drop or subject to strong impact
Otherwise, you risk causing damage 
or malfunction. 
 
 
 
Do not share an outlet with an unreasonable 
number of other devices
Otherwise, you risk overheating or 
re.

 CAUTION
Place in a well ventilated location
The unit should be located so that 
its location or position does not 
interfere with its proper ventilation. 
Use only the specied stand(s)
This unit is designed to be used in 
combination with specic stands 
(KS-G8, KS-G8B) manufactured by 
Roland. If used in combination with 
other stands, you risk sustaining injuries as 
the result of this product dropping down or 
toppling over due to a lack of stability.
Evaluate safety issues before using stands
Even if you observe the cautions 
given in the owner’s manual, certain 
types of handling may allow this 
product to fall from the stand, or 
cause the stand to overturn. Please be 
mindful of any safety issues before using this 
product.
When disconnecting the power cord, grasp it by 
the plug
To prevent conductor damage, 
always grasp the power cord by its 
plug when disconnecting it from 
this unit or from a power outlet.
Periodically clean the power plug
An accumulation of dust or foreign 
objects between the power plug 
and the power outlet can lead to re 
or electric shock. 
At regular intervals, be sure to pull 
out the power plug, and using a dry cloth, 
wipe away any dust or foreign objects that 
may have accumulated.
Disconnect the power plug whenever the unit 
will not be used for an extended period of time
Fire may result in the unlikely event 
that a breakdown occurs. 
 
 
 
Route all power cords and cables in such a way as 
to prevent them from getting entangled
Injury could result if someone were 
to trip on a cable and cause the unit 
to fall or topple. 
Avoid climbing on top of the unit, or placing 
heavy objects on it
Otherwise, you risk injury as the 
result of the unit toppling over or 
dropping down. 
 
 
Never connect/disconnect a power plug if your 
hands are wet
Otherwise, you could receive an 
electric shock. 
 
 
 
 
Disconnect all cords/cables before moving the 
unit
Before moving the unit, disconnect 
the power plug from the outlet, and 
pull out all cords from external 
devices.
Before cleaning the unit, disconnect the power 
plug from the outlet
If the power plug is not removed 
from the outlet, you risk receiving an 
electric shock.
 
Whenever there is a threat of lightning, 
disconnect the power plug from the outlet
If the power plug is not removed 
from the outlet, you risk receiving an 
electric shock.
